IEMbase phenotype signal

IEMbase represents this as GNS-related N-acetylglucosamine 6-sulfatase deficiency, with alternate labels Sanfilippo D disease, mucopolysaccharidosis type 3D, and MPS IIID. The record is autosomal recessive and treatability is marked yes, with no treatment rows in the cached JSON.

Biochemical rows include decreased N-acetylglucosamine-6-sulfatase activity in white blood cells, increased urinary heparan sulfate, and increased total glycosaminoglycans. Clinical rows include Alder-Reilly anomaly, coarse facial features, dysostosis multiplex, hearing loss, liver dysfunction, and neurologic regression. Characteristic rows include aggressive behavior, diarrhea, hyperactivity, intellectual disability, seizures, and swallowing difficulties.

DisMech phenotype coverage

Sanfilippo_syndrome.yaml#MPS IIID is the correct local target. The local file has subtype coverage for GNS-related Sanfilippo syndrome type D/ N-acetylglucosamine-6-sulfatase deficiency and covers the shared Sanfilippo mechanism of autosomal recessive heparan sulfate catabolic failure, lysosomal heparan sulfate accumulation, progressive neurodegeneration, intellectual disability, developmental regression, behavioral problems, hyperactivity, seizures, swallowing and feeding difficulty, hearing and visual impairment, and mild systemic MPS features.
